Crime needs three things: desire, ability and opportunity. We can't take away the desire or the ability, but we can remove the opportunity and then a crime can't be completed.

 

IN YOUR HOME:

  • Keep entry/exit doors to your home closed and know where the keys are located.
  • Have your house keys in your hand as you approach the door and use it as a weapon if necessary.
  • Leave a T.V. or radio on when you are away from home.
  • Keep gifts/valuables out of view of windows and doors.

 

 

IN YOUR CAR:

  • Have a good working car and plan your route. Drive with a purpose.
  • Keep your car doors locked.
  • Check the back seat of your car to make sure no one is hiding there.
  • Put your purse and other valuables on the floor or in the trunk even while driving.
  • In parking structures, go toward the light. Park where there is traffic, not in the back where it's quiet and dark. Criminals like it quiet and dark.
  • Use your inner sense of self-preservation. Trust your instincts. If you feel uncomfortable, if something doesn't feel right, don't get out of your car.
  • If you think you're being followed, drive to a police station or a well-lit gas station.

IF A CRISIS HAPPENS:

  • If they want your money/valuables, give it to them. It's much better to do that than argue.
  • If someone grabs you, never allow the person to force you into a vehicle.
  • Cause a scene. Wave your arms. Yell 'Fire!' It attracts people.
  • Fight back and escape. Run!
